iOS中获取要要保存到相册中的图片
2016-11-30 19:48
274 查看
在之前的一篇博客中我们给出了创建相册的两种方式(http://blog.csdn.net/u010105969/article/details/53412400),在利用方式二进行图片的保存的时候,我们可以获取到这张图片。我们为什么要获取这张图片呢?这是为了将此图片保存到我们自己创建的App自定义的相册中。
代码:
// 获取要保存的图片
- (PHFetchResult<PHAsset *> *)createAsset{
NSError * error =
nil;
__block
NSString * assetID =
nil;
[[PHPhotoLibrary
sharedPhotoLibrary]
performChangesAndWait:^{
assetID = [PHAssetChangeRequest
creationRequestForAssetFromImage:self.imageV.image].placeholderForCreatedAsset.localIdentifier;
} error:&error];
if (error)
return nil;
return [PHAsset
fetchAssetsWithLocalIdentifiers:@[assetID]
options:nil];
}
代码:
// 获取要保存的图片
- (PHFetchResult<PHAsset *> *)createAsset{
NSError * error =
nil;
__block
NSString * assetID =
nil;
[[PHPhotoLibrary
sharedPhotoLibrary]
performChangesAndWait:^{
assetID = [PHAssetChangeRequest
creationRequestForAssetFromImage:self.imageV.image].placeholderForCreatedAsset.localIdentifier;
} error:&error];
if (error)
return nil;
return [PHAsset
fetchAssetsWithLocalIdentifiers:@[assetID]
options:nil];
}
相关文章推荐
- 【学习ios之路:UI系列】获取通过UIImagePackerController获取的系统相册图片的名称信息及保存系统相册到本地
- iOS 系统相册获取图片,保存图片,以及剪切图片
- iOS 把图片保存到相册,并获取图片文件名
- iOS 把图片保存到相册,并获取图片文件名的实例
- ios实现视频录制功能 三 获取视频、保存到相册、根据视频生成占位图片
- 修正iOS从照相机和相册中获取的图片 方向
- IOS UIImagePickerController从拍照、图库、相册获取图片
- iOS 之图片拖拽、捏合、双击缩放以及保存到相册
- Android 代码片段---从相册或相机获取图片保存并处理
- iOS 图片保存手机相册
- 修正iOS从照相机和相册中获取的图片方向(转)
- ios中摄像头/相册获取图片,压缩图片,上传服务器方法总结
- IOS 使用相机或者在相册里获取图片
- iOS 开发批量保存图片到相册时丢图片的解决方法
- iOS 保存和获取本地图片的封装函数
- 【移动开发】Android相机、相册获取图片显示并保存到SD卡
- 修正iOS从照相机和相册中获取的图片方向
- ios选择相册图片并保存
- iOS-将图片保存到照片相册中
- iOS 图片 保存到沙盒路径/相册、图片缩小、图片截取